Catherine has over 8 years' experience as a Physical Therapist working with clients from sporting and non-sporting backgrounds. She complements her role as a physical therapist with her background in fitness instruction. Catherine is a qualified Stott Pilates teacher and combines this with massage, dry needling and kinesio taping in her treatments. She loves to be active and has a personal interest in Astanga Yoga and cycling, completing cycling sportives around the country incorporating working as a physical therapist with the Dundrum Cycling team for the FBD Ras 2006.

Robert is a member of the Irish Society of Chartered Physiotherapists. He received an honours degree from the Royal College of Surgeons in Ireland in 2009 after completing a previous 4-year honours degree in Sports Science and Health from Dublin City University. Over the past 4 years Robert has worked in a variety of settings including acute hospitals, rehabilitation, aged care facilities and private practices. Robert spent 2 years working in the National Rehab Hospital in Dun Laoghaire, where he worked with patients with respiratory issues, traumatic and non-traumatic brain injuries, spinal chord injuries and amputations. He also worked in Australia in a large aged care facility with residents who had various issues that affect the elderly, such as weakness, poor balance, difficulty with mobility and transfers, respiratory problems, dementia and chronic pain. Before his career as a physiotherapist Robert completed an N.C.E.F. physical instructor qualification and a level 1 TICA Tennis Coaching qualification. Robert has worked as a physical trainer and tennis coach at all levels of tennis in ireland from beginners to national squad level. During his playing career, Robert represented Leinster and Ireland at junior level and was nationally and internationally ranked.
